The TOPDON BT100 Car Battery Tester is a reliable tool for assessing the health of 12V lead-acid batteries. It provides clear readings on State of Health (SOH), State of Charge (SOC), voltage, current, and more. This tester is compatible with various battery types, including regular flooded, AGM, EFB, and GEL, making it versatile for automotive, motorcycle, and marine applications.
The device features three testing functions: a battery health test, a cranking test to check the electrical system’s power, and a charging test to ensure the generator and rectifier are functioning properly. The user-friendly LED indicators simplify the process, allowing for quick assessments.
With its compact size, the TOPDON BT100 fits easily in a glove box or center console. The premium-quality copper clamps ensure a secure connection, and the safety features prevent sparks and reverse polarity issues. Faq about Battery Alternator and Starter Tester:
1:What is a battery alternator and starter tester?
A battery alternator and starter tester is a device used to analyze the performance of a vehicle’s battery, alternator, and starter system.
2:Why do I need a battery alternator and starter tester?
This tester helps diagnose issues with your vehicle’s electrical system, ensuring reliable starting and proper charging.
3:How does a battery alternator and starter tester work?
The tester measures voltage, current, and resistance to evaluate the health of the battery, alternator, and starter motor.
4:Can I use a battery alternator and starter tester on all vehicles?
Most testers are compatible with a wide range of vehicles, but always check the specifications for your specific model.
5:What are the signs that I need to test my battery, alternator, or starter?
Common signs include dimming lights, slow engine crank, or warning lights on the dashboard.
6:How often should I test my battery and alternator?
It is advisable to test these components at least once a year or before long trips.
7:Can I perform the test myself?
Yes, many testers are designed for easy use, allowing DIY enthusiasts to perform tests without professional help.
